Trying to create USB startup - crash report only

Asked by Rosengeek

Using Ubuntu 8.10 booted on a PC from CD. I choose"create USB startup" from the system/accessories menu.
Tried 3 different memory sticks, one at a time. S/W correctly recognises which has enough space. I don't care whether it overwrites the memory stick or archives what's there ...
Immediately I get to the "Installing - starting up" screen I get "Crash report detected".
What's wrong ? - how to overcome ? thanks in anticipation
